ABSTRACT:

This inventions relates to snowplow assemblies and particularly to lightweight snowplow assemblies constructed and arranged for attachment to the front of a vehicle, such as an automobile or like small vehicle.
Although prior art snowplow assemblies have been proposed and manufactured for use with vehicles, these assemblies have typically had various shortcomings that limit the use and function of the snowplow. Although snowplow assemblies have included those used for automobiles, for example, most prior art assemblies are either complex and heavy for small vehicle use or are constructed in such a manner that they are difficult and inefficient to use. Other prior art devices have been found difficult to assemble, difficult to install on a vehicle and difficult to remove after use.
The lightweight snowplow assembly of the present invention overcomes the shortcomings and difficulties of the prior art snowplow assemblies. The snowplow assembly of the present invention is lightweight and economical in construction. The assembly is constructed and arranged so that it is easily assembled, adjusted and installed on the front of a vehicle. The snowplow assembly is adapted for a wide range of use on the front of a variety of vehicle designs. The lightweight nature of the snowplow -assembly of this invention provides an efficient and economical plow assembly for automobiles, mini-vans, light trucks, medium size sport utility vehicles and the like. Although the lightweight snowplow assemblies are well suited for smaller vehicles, it is within the purview of the invention to enable the utilization of the snowplow assemblies with larger vehicles, for example, 4×4 trucks. In the latter case, the assemblies would be in larger scale for adaptation to the larger front dimensions (width and height) of the vehicle.
The snowplow assembly of the invention has a flexible V-shaped blade structure suited for use with smaller vehicles. The snowplow assembly further is constructed and arranged to be free floating to, thereby, be usable for plowing on various surfaces.
S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
The lightweight snowplow assembly of this invention is mounted to a vehicle and used for snow removal. The snowplow assembly is easily assembled and can be readily mounted onto and removed from the front of an automobile or similar small vehicle. The assembly is constructed and arranged for easy adjustable attachment to the front of the vehicle, and the assembly is adapted to be adjusted to fit a variety of automobile and small vehicle sizes and configurations.
The lightweight snowplow assembly is comprised of a V-shaped snowplow blade portion and a cooperating harness or mounting structure. The snowplow portion is comprised of a plurality of blade members to form the V-shaped blade portion and is mounted to a support frame structure for attachment to the harness or mounting frame structure. The blade elements of the snowplow portion have wear pads mounted on the bottom thereof and the blade elements of the snowplow are positioned to form an obtuse angle to push and remove snow. Further chute structures are mounted on the top of the side blade members of the snowplow blade portion to guide snow away from the plow for snow removal purposes.
The harness or mounting structure of the snowplow assembly is comprised of a mounting frame and means to attach the harness portion to the snowplow portion. The mounting structure of the snowplow assembly is constructed and arranged to connect the assembly to the front of a vehicle. The harness or mounting portion has bumper pad elements to mount the snowplow assembly with respect to the bumper of the vehicle. The pads are provided to protect the car bumper from damage and to direct forces to the plow assembly from the vehicle bumper during plowing.
The harness portion further has adjustable strap members which are adapted to be easily adjusted during assembly and to provide for the attachment of the snowplow assembly to different sizes and front end configurations of a range of vehicles. The strap members include a pair of upper and lower straps that attach to predetermined positions above and below the bumper of the vehicle. A biasing structure operative between the snowplow portion and the harness assembly is also provided to maintain the snowplow in a downward position during operation.
